BRIDGEPORT, Conn. (AP) — Jerry Johnson Jr. led five Fairfield players in double figures with 18 points and the Stags pulled away from Niagara in an 81-61 victory on Thursday night.
Amadou Sidibe and Tyler Nelson each scored 16 points, with Nelson snagging 10 rebounds. Curtis Cobb finished with 15 points, and Deniz Celen chipped in 10 for Fairfield (11-10, 6-6 MAAC).
The Stags shot 50 percent from the field overall, hit 11 3-pointers, and finished with 25 assists on their 33 field goals.
